Danish PM warns US ‘aggression’ over Greenland

On 9 January 2026, former Danish prime minister Helle Thorning‑Schmidt told Sky News that Denmark feels “bullied” by the United States over the semi‑autonomous island of Greenland. She described the US request to strengthen its presence in Greenland as an “act of aggression” that could undermine NATO and Denmark’s sovereignty. The comments come after President Donald Trump reiterated his interest in Greenland for national‑security reasons, and White House spokesperson Karoline Leavitt confirmed that the acquisition is “actively discussed” by the president’s national‑security team. Thorning‑Schmidt warned that any hostile move would be disastrous for Denmark, NATO and even could play into the interests of Putin and Xi. The former PM was speaking on the “Electoral Dysfunction” podcast for Sky News.
